Company Description
Arabian American Development Co. engages in the manufacturing and sale of various specialty petrochemical products, as well as the development of mineral properties in Saudi Arabia and the United States. The company owns interest in Al Masane Al Kobra, a Saudi Arabian closed joint stock mining company and Pioche Ely Valley Mines, Inc., a Nevada mining corporation which presently does not conduct any substantial business activity but owns undeveloped properties in the United States. Arabian American Development was founded in 1967 and is headquartered in Sugar Land, TX.
